Ian Schaid moved to Boston, Massachusetts in the fall of 2014 from Long Beach, California to enroll at Berklee College of Music. As an avid musician in high school he went through an exploration period early on as a guitarist in rock bands to quickly change to playing crossover jazz. Ian’s gigging life of jazz music with his sextet inspired him to create arrangements and eventually the discovery of his own compositional sound. His music was met with a large audience for the first time when playing with his sextet at The Gardenia Jazz Festival 2014.

Since starting at Berklee, Ian is consistently developing his musical voice through different channels of composition. In scoring his first short films Genui in December of 2016 followed by Just Us in April 2017, he was well received by the audience and teachers of Directing at Emerson College when premiered at the Paramount Theatre in Boston. He has continued working with directors from Emerson and expanding to work with other student directors at Massachusetts School of Art and Design. 

Along a different line of film he has also become a skilled commercial writer consisting of product lines, movie trailers, and writing songs for commercials.

Ian is also actively playing with bands in the local Boston and Long Beach music circuit. In studying abroad in Valencia, Spain he became an official member of The Interlopers as a funk/R&B/rock group that has now toured parts of Europe and the North East. They released the debut single, Elevation in November of 2016. The single was featured in Best of Boston Music: 30 Top Songs of 2016Through the study abroad program he has also joined Jacksonville Kid, an Americana Folk revival with nuances of an indie rock band who released their first single in mid March of 2017 and have already recorded an EP to follow with plans to release in the summer. Ian also continues to play his contemporary jazz compositions with his group ENwhich has fluctuating members at all times and is a constant arranging process.

Through playing live and writing in different mediums Ian has worked with people across the United States and in Europe. He is currently residing in Boston however is eagerly planing to move to the greater Los Angeles area to create, collaborate, and overall bring new ideas to the table.
